NASCAR’s next generation heads out west this weekend. The second race of the NASCAR Nationwide Series’ 2014 season takes the series to Phoenix International Speedway for the Blue Jeans Go Green 200. ABC will have all of the action beginning with NASCAR Countdown at 3:30pm. The green flag is expected to drop at 4pm ET/1pm PT.
All eyes will be on the current NNS points leader Regan Smith when the NASCAR Nationwide Series takes to the track at Phoenix International Speedway this weekend. Smith, who has been an underdog since his NASCAR Sprint Cup debut at the 2007 Daytona 500, looks to keep his momentum going from last weekend’s huge win. He currently sits atop the NNS points standings, six points ahead of Trevor Bayne, who won the 2011 Daytona 500.
Allen Bestwick will call all of the lap-by-lap action for Saturday’s broadcast. He will be joined by former Winston Cup Champion and ESPN analyst Dale Jarrett and former crew chief Andy Petree. More information on this weekend’s coverage is available online at http://espn.go.com/racing/nascar.
